@vuejs_ru
Vue.js — русскоговорящее сообщество

Общаемся на темы, посвященные Vue.js и опыту его использования. Проблемы. Новости. Решения. См. также: @js_ru, @react_js, @angular_ru, @nuxtjs_ru Вакансии только тут: @javascript_jobs

3988 members

Архив канала @vuejs_ru 13 декабря 2016 г.

09:53:46 ДП
User 55423102
Весело, обновился на 2.1.5, в паре мест отвалился рендер дочерних компонентов) и вместо них undefined текст показывается
09:54:01 ДП
10:08:48 ДП
User 152816933
У меня вроде ничо
11:28:30 ДП
User 55423102
С горем пополам удалось повторить баг) посмотрим что ответят
11:50:58 ДП
02:46:56 ПП
User 95505103
привет, ребята. Нужна небольшая помощь по vue.js
Я начал изучать его только.
02:47:36 ПП
User 108562525
Спрашивай 😏
02:51:56 ПП
User 95505103
В общем. У меня допустим слева есть. Список моих контактов. При клике на который мне надо динамически создать новый елемент поля чата(поле ввода и переписка с юзером). А также возможность переключения между полями. т.е. Если я нажал на юзера а поля еще нету то надо создать, если оно уже есть. то надо открыть. И если пришло сообщение(webSocket) надо дописать его именно в то место, где я чатюсь с этим юзером, от которого пришло. 

Эта реализация всего уже есть на js&Jquery Но хочется чего-то нового.
02:52:04 ПП
User 95505103
Буду раз если есть где гайды для подобного
02:52:13 ПП
User 95505103
или хоть укажете в какую сторону копать
02:54:49 ПП
User 55423102
Например такой — http://vuejsexamples.com/chat-example-by-vue-js-webpack/
vuejsexamples.com/chat-example-by-vue-js-webpack
Chat by Vue + Webpack Live demo Live demo Setup npm install # build: npm run build # start the server and watch (localhost:8080) npm run dev GitHub
02:54:52 ПП
02:56:32 ПП
User 95505103
тут момент такой. Я с webpack не знаком. (((
02:57:59 ПП
User 55423102
Может лучше всё же познакомиться?)
02:58:47 ПП
User 55423102
Ну содержимое проекта можешь и так посмотреть
02:59:16 ПП
User 95505103
В чем полезность webpack?
02:59:27 ПП
User 95505103
и очень ли он надо) Я просто backend)
02:59:36 ПП
User 55423102
Потом им можно будет удобно собирать vue файлы
02:59:39 ПП
User 95505103
Но хочу немного разгрестись с frontendom
03:00:03 ПП
User 95505103
User 55423102
Потом им можно будет удобно собирать vue файлы
За это я смотрел. Это хорошо
03:01:17 ПП
User 55423102
Я почти сразу на них перешёл и не жалею
03:02:12 ПП
User 55423102
А так, много чего встречается в Гугле по vue.js + chat. Посмотри, а что непонятно попробуем разобраться)
03:03:07 ПП
User 95505103
Хорошо. Спасибо_)
03:12:32 ПП
User 152816933
Что бы запустить пример, не надо знать webpack :) Достаточно команды на запуск dev сборки. Что-то типа npm run dev. Потом магия в ящике будет сама обновлять файлы, браузер и т.д.
03:12:55 ПП
User 95505103
Спасибо. Буду ковыряться.
03:12:58 ПП
User 95505103
Если что отпишу.
03:13:28 ПП
User 229165046
там написано)
03:13:48 ПП
User 152816933
тем более ))
06:01:36 ПП
User 55423102
ура, пофиксили регрессию
06:01:39 ПП
User 55423102
завтра можно будет обновиться
06:10:11 ПП
User 552804
кто нибудь атом юзает? как сделать множественный курсор?
06:10:33 ПП
06:10:45 ПП
User 133750577
Shift + левый клик
06:10:50 ПП
User 108562525
User 552804
кто нибудь атом юзает? как сделать множественный курсор?
alt shift down
06:10:59 ПП
User 133750577
Насчет второго не уверен
06:10:59 ПП
User 108562525
либо ctrl+click
06:11:17 ПП
User 552804
User 108562525
alt shift down
чтото не работает у меня
06:11:27 ПП
User 552804
с контралом понятно
06:11:32 ПП
User 552804
именно стрелками хотелось
06:12:19 ПП
User 108562525
Ctrl+Shift+P → Show Key (bindings) → Enter
06:12:42 ПП
User 108562525
editor:add-selection-below
06:13:16 ПП
User 552804
контрл альт даун
06:13:18 ПП
User 552804
блин
06:13:20 ПП
User 108562525
У тебя, наверное, мак, там могут быть другие хоткеи.
06:13:27 ПП
User 552804
винда
06:13:36 ПП
User 108562525
А, ну вот как. У меня linux.
06:13:50 ПП
User 552804
самый тупняк в моем ноуте, при этой комбинации у меня переварачивает изображение экрана))
06:13:52 ПП
User 552804
щас поменяю
06:14:23 ПП
User 552804
ой, а поменять то можно?
06:14:39 ПП
User 55423102
https://atom.io/packages/multi-cursor или https://atom.io/packages/multi-cursor-plus ?
atom.io/packages/multi-cursor
Atom package to expand your current cursor.
06:15:37 ПП
User 552804
спасибо, полезно
06:16:51 ПП
User 55423102
а у меня он что-то не прижился
06:16:57 ПП
User 108562525
Есть другой способ
06:17:09 ПП
User 108562525
User 108562525
Ctrl+Shift+P → Show Key (bindings) → Enter
Там с каждой командой есть возможность скопипастить её
06:17:14 ПП
User 55423102
если отходишь на какое-то время или ноут на ночь оставался заблокированный, то по возвращению атом встречал дикими лагами в рендере
06:17:16 ПП
User 108562525
Или Ctrl+Shift+P → keymap
И добавляешь копипасту.
06:17:47 ПП
User 552804
ну у меня сублим как основной, просто интересно атом настроить под себя
06:19:12 ПП
User 152816933
Предлагаю попробовать Visual Studio Code
06:19:30 ПП
User 55423102
вот и я тоже на vs code пока остановился)
06:19:46 ПП
User 108562525
а мне как-то не прижился.
06:26:58 ПП
User 552804
User 152816933
Предлагаю попробовать Visual Studio Code
пhобовал тоже
06:27:10 ПП
User 552804
у меня пока сублим только прижился
06:27:22 ПП
User 552804
хочется нового пощупать, хотя и сублим полностью устраивает))
06:28:26 ПП
User 152816933
User 552804
у меня пока сублим только прижился
Я с саблайма на VSCode ушел. Теперь саблайм только для быстрого редактирования
06:29:26 ПП
User 552804
щас VSCode открою, поковыряю)
06:40:37 ПП
User 109705347
Кста, ребят, а есть няшная поддержка .vue в VSCode? та пара расширений которые находятся не тащут автокомплит в js вроде как..
06:57:43 ПП
06:57:48 ПП
User 152816933
У меня такое стоит
06:57:57 ПП
User 152816933
Не помню, вроде работает
07:44:27 ПП
User 152816933
2.1.6 зарелизилось
07:44:39 ПП
User 152816933
Кстати, а есть уже бот, который релизы шлет
07:44:40 ПП